While fans have expressed frustration over some of Call of Duty: Warzone's design decisions, the battle royale game has remained immensely popular, with Warzone hitting 60 million players in the few short months since launch. The game has had its ups and downs, but a new glitch seems to suggest something big may be headed its way.

Players are beginning to report miniguns dropping in Warzonethough they're glitched and can't be used. Instead, the weapon just floats there, fully modeled. Those familiar with Modern Warfare's multiplayer will recognize the minigun as the Juggernaut killstreak's weapon, which allows players to rip through others on the map. Some believe Juggernauts may be headed to Warzone because of the weapon.

It's unlikely that the Juggernaut would be featured as a standard killstreak in Warzone, as it would be a bit overpowered and doesn't really fit with Warzone's gameplay style. However, some believe that Juggernauts will get their own Warzone playlist, allowing all players to fight over the armor and a machine gun, helping them survive to the end of the round. This has been supported by prominent Call of Duty leaker ModernWarzone, who claims that a Juggernaut mode has been in the game's files for some time.

A Juggernaut mode would certainly be a twist, changing up the Warzone formula players are familiar with. With the possibility of changes coming to Warzone's map next season, it makes sense that Infinity Ward would want to dry something new with the game, even if that means spicing it up with a unique mode.

Playlist rotations aren't new to Call of Duty: Warzone, either, sometimes to the chagrin of players, in the case of Warzone's trios mode. That said, it's also possible that the Minigun will simply be added as a legendary weapon, forgoing the suit and keeping the other aspects of Warzone in place. Right now, a dedicated Juggernaut mode is just speculation, and should be taken with a grain of salt.

Juggernaut is one of Modern Warfare's more interesting killstreaks. It didn't stir up as much controversy as Modern Warfare's white phosphorous, though that isn't a bad thing. If the Juggernaut mode is real, players can likely expect it sometime during Season 4, but it's still too early to tell.
